Lipids
Lipids are constituents of plants and tissues that are insoluble in water although soluble in organic solvents like ether, carbon tetrachloride, chloroform, or benzene. They added a large kind of elements of varying structures like oils and fats; steroids, phospholipids and so on. Lipids are commonly prepared of oxygen, hydrogen, and carbon. Some oxygen atoms in a lipid molecule is all time small than the number of carbon molecules. Sometimes small number of nitrogen, phosphorus and sulphur as well exist. They comprise a large portion of their structure such as a hydrocarbon. Lipids offer as energy save for make use in metabolism and as a main structural material in cell membranes for regulating the activities of cell and tissues.
